C語言程序設(shè)計與實(shí)驗(yàn)指導(dǎo)(第2版)
定 價:43 元
叢書名:高等學(xué)校機(jī)械基礎(chǔ)課程系列教材
- 作者:侯清蘭,倪倩 編
- 出版時間:2016/8/1
- ISBN:9787568229388
- 出 版 社:北京理工大學(xué)出版社
- 中圖法分類:TP312C
- 頁碼:224
- 紙張:膠版紙
- 版次:2
- 開本:16開
《C語言程序設(shè)計與實(shí)驗(yàn)指導(dǎo)(第2版)》較為全面地介紹了C語言程序設(shè)計的基本語法、程序設(shè)計的基本思想及傳統(tǒng)的結(jié)構(gòu)化程序設(shè)計的一般方法;介紹了C語言程序設(shè)計實(shí)驗(yàn)。《C語言程序設(shè)計與實(shí)驗(yàn)指導(dǎo)(第2版)》共分11章,第1~10章為C語言程序設(shè)計篇,第11章為實(shí)驗(yàn)篇。
《C語言程序設(shè)計與實(shí)驗(yàn)指導(dǎo)(第2版)》結(jié)構(gòu)清晰、內(nèi)容詳實(shí)、深入淺出、注重實(shí)用、易學(xué)易用,可作為高等院校工科專業(yè)的教材使用,也可供從事計算機(jī)技術(shù)的工程技術(shù)人員學(xué)習(xí)參考。
第1章 C語言程序設(shè)計基礎(chǔ)
1.1 簡單C語言程序的構(gòu)成和格式
1.2 C語言的特點(diǎn)
練習(xí)題
第2章 數(shù)據(jù)類型與運(yùn)算
2.1 常量與變量
2.1.1 常量與符號常量
2.1.2 變量
2.2 整型數(shù)據(jù)
2.2.1 整型常量
2.2.2 整型變量
2.2.3 整型數(shù)據(jù)的分類
2.3 實(shí)型數(shù)據(jù)
2.3.1 實(shí)型常量
2.3.2 實(shí)型變量
2.4 字符型數(shù)據(jù)
2.4.1 字符常量
2.4.2 字符變量
2.5 各種數(shù)據(jù)類型間的混合運(yùn)算
2.6 算數(shù)運(yùn)算符和算數(shù)表達(dá)式
2.6.1 基本算術(shù)運(yùn)算符和算術(shù)表達(dá)式
2.6.2 算術(shù)運(yùn)算符的優(yōu)先級和結(jié)合性
2.6.3 強(qiáng)制類型轉(zhuǎn)換運(yùn)算符
2.6.4 自加、自減運(yùn)算符
2.7 賦值運(yùn)算符和賦值表達(dá)式
2.7.1 賦值運(yùn)算符和賦值表達(dá)式
2.7.2 復(fù)合的賦值運(yùn)算符
2.7.3 賦值運(yùn)算中的類型轉(zhuǎn)換
2.8 關(guān)系運(yùn)算和邏輯運(yùn)算
2.8.1 關(guān)系運(yùn)算符和關(guān)系表達(dá)式
2.8.2 邏輯運(yùn)算符和邏輯表達(dá)式
2.9 逗號運(yùn)算符和逗號表達(dá)式
2.10 位運(yùn)算
練習(xí)題
第3章 順序結(jié)構(gòu)
3.1 C語句概述
3.2 數(shù)據(jù)的輸入/輸出格式
3.2.1 printf函數(shù)
3.2.2 scanf函數(shù)
3.3 字符數(shù)據(jù)輸入/輸出
3.3.1 putchar函數(shù)
3.3.2 getchar函數(shù)
3.4 程序舉例
練習(xí)題
第4章 選擇結(jié)構(gòu)
4.1 if語句
4.1.1 if語句的3種基本形式
4.1.2 嵌套的if語句
4.2 switch語句
4.3 條件運(yùn)算符和條件表達(dá)式
練習(xí)題
第5章 循環(huán)結(jié)構(gòu)
5.1 用while語句構(gòu)成循環(huán)
5.2 用do-while語句構(gòu)成循環(huán)
5.3 用for語句構(gòu)成循環(huán)
5.4 循環(huán)的嵌套
5.5 break語句和continue語句
5.5.1 break語句
5.5.2 continue語句
練習(xí)題
第6章 數(shù)組與字符串
6.1 一維數(shù)組
6.2 二維數(shù)組
6.3 字符數(shù)組
6.3.1 字符數(shù)組的定義和初始化
6.3.2 字符數(shù)組的輸入和輸出
6.4 字符串處理函數(shù)
練習(xí)題
第7章 函數(shù)
7.1 函數(shù)的定義和返回值
7.2 函數(shù)的調(diào)用
7.2.1 函數(shù)調(diào)用的形式
7.2.2 對被調(diào)用函數(shù)的說明
7.2.3 函數(shù)間變量作參數(shù)的傳遞
7.2.4 函數(shù)的嵌套調(diào)用和遞歸調(diào)用
7.3 函數(shù)間數(shù)組做參數(shù)的傳遞
7.3.1 數(shù)組元素作函數(shù)實(shí)參
7.3.2 數(shù)組名作函數(shù)實(shí)參
7.4 局部變量和全局變量
7.4.1 局部變量
7.4.2 全局變量
7.5 變量的存儲類別
7.5.1 局部變量的存儲類別
7.5.2 全局變量的存儲類別
7.6 編譯預(yù)處理
7.6.1 宏定義和調(diào)用
7.6.2 文件包含
練習(xí)題
第8章 指針
8.1 指針和指針變量的概念
8.2 用指針訪問變量
8.2.1 指針變量的定義、賦值
8.2.2 指針變量的引用
8.3 數(shù)組與指針
8.3.1 一維數(shù)組與指針
8.3.2 二維數(shù)組與指針
8.4 字符串與指針
8.5 指針作函數(shù)參數(shù)
8.5.1 指針變量作函數(shù)參數(shù)
8.5.2 數(shù)組名作函數(shù)參數(shù)
8.5.3 字符指針作函數(shù)參數(shù)
8.6 返回指針值的函數(shù)
8.7 指針數(shù)組和指向指針的指針
8.7.1 指針數(shù)組
8.7.2 指向指針的指針
8.8 函數(shù)的進(jìn)一步討論
8.8.1 main()函數(shù)的參數(shù)
8.8.2 指向函數(shù)指針變量的定義
練習(xí)題
第9章 結(jié)構(gòu)體與共用體
9.1 用typedef定義新類型
9.2 結(jié)構(gòu)體類型
9.2.1 結(jié)構(gòu)體類型的定義
9.2.2 結(jié)構(gòu)體變量定義、成員引用和初始化
9.2.3 結(jié)構(gòu)體數(shù)組的定義、初始化和引用舉例
9.2.4 結(jié)構(gòu)體指針變量
9.2.5 結(jié)構(gòu)體在函數(shù)內(nèi)的傳遞
9.2.6 用結(jié)構(gòu)體構(gòu)成鏈表
9.3 共用體類型
9.3.1 共用體變量的定義
9.3.2 共用體變量的成員引用
9.3.3 共用體類型數(shù)據(jù)的特點(diǎn)
練習(xí)題
第10章 文件
10.1 C語言文件的概念
10.2 文件類型指針
10.3 文件的打開和關(guān)閉
10.3.1 文件的打開(fopen函數(shù))
10.3.2 文件的關(guān)閉(fclose函數(shù))
10.4 文件的讀/寫
10.4.1 垮etc函數(shù)和fputc函數(shù)
10.4.2 龜ets函數(shù)和fputs函數(shù)
10.4.3 fread函數(shù)和fwrite函數(shù)
10.4.4 fseanf和fprintf函數(shù)
10.5 文件的定位與檢測
10.5.1 文件的定位
10.5.2 文件的檢測函數(shù)
練習(xí)題
第11章 C語言上機(jī)指導(dǎo)
11.1 實(shí)驗(yàn)1:熟悉c語言的運(yùn)行環(huán)境
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.2 實(shí)驗(yàn)2:數(shù)據(jù)類型和運(yùn)算符的運(yùn)用
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.3實(shí)驗(yàn)3:格式輸入/輸出
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.4 實(shí)驗(yàn)4:選擇語句的應(yīng)用
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.5 實(shí)驗(yàn)5:while和dowhile語句的應(yīng)用
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.6 實(shí)驗(yàn)6:for語句和嵌套循環(huán)語句的應(yīng)用
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.7 實(shí)驗(yàn)7:一維數(shù)組的應(yīng)用
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.8 實(shí)驗(yàn)8:二維數(shù)組的應(yīng)用
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.9 實(shí)驗(yàn)9:字符數(shù)組的應(yīng)用
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.10 實(shí)驗(yàn)10:函數(shù)的定義和調(diào)用
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.11 實(shí)驗(yàn)11:數(shù)組作為函數(shù)參數(shù)
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.12 實(shí)驗(yàn)12:指針變量的定義、數(shù)組和指針
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.13 實(shí)驗(yàn)13:結(jié)構(gòu)體的應(yīng)用
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
11.14 實(shí)驗(yàn)14:綜合練習(xí)
實(shí)驗(yàn)?zāi)康?br>實(shí)驗(yàn)內(nèi)容
附錄1 C語言中的關(guān)鍵字
附錄2 C語言中的運(yùn)算符及優(yōu)先級
附錄3 常用字符與ASCII碼對照表
附錄4 庫函數(shù)